[
https://issues.apache.org/jira/browse/AMQ-5923?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15237229#comment-15237229
]
ASF subversion and git services commented on AMQ-5923:
------------------------------------------------------
Commit 485fcafcdfbb71b254977bbe5a670472aaaa4081 in activemq's branch
refs/heads/master from [~cshannon]
[ https://git-wip-us.apache.org/repos/asf?p=activemq.git;h=485fcaf ]
https://issues.apache.org/jira/browse/AMQ-5923
Updating tests to check prioritized messages as well
> Add Pending Message Size Metrics
> --------------------------------
>
> Key: AMQ-5923
> URL: https://issues.apache.org/jira/browse/AMQ-5923
> Project: ActiveMQ
> Issue Type: New Feature
> Components: Broker
> Reporter: Christopher L. Shannon
> Assignee: Christopher L. Shannon
> Fix For: 5.13.0
>
>
> Right now the PendingMessageCursor keeps track of the number of pending
> messages (the size() method). It would be useful to also report back the
> total message size besides just the count so we know how much memory or disk
> space is being used by pending messages.
> Now that KahaDB is keeping track of the size of each message as of 5.12, it
> should be possible to report back this value in a non-blocking way. For a
> Queue this is pretty straightforward but for DurableSubscriptions some work
> will need to be done to keep track of the message size for unacked messages
> for each subscription.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)